Goalkeeper from Ukraine Nazar Domchak expressed his opinion on the move from the Lviv Carpathians to Slavia Prague.

The day before, the 19-year-old goalkeeper officially became a player for the reigning Czech champions, signing a contract until the summer of 2031.

" As soon as I heard about their interest, I went online and watched videos of the matches. The atmosphere, the fans - it was incredible.

I already had the opportunity to see the stadium in person, it is really beautiful. And, of course, Slavia is the strongest club in the Czech Republic, they became champions this year, so congratulations to everyone. I have great motivation to work hard, achieve results and make the fans happy.

I hope the adaptation will go very quickly. I'm working on taking a step forward and going from the Carpathians to Slavia is a really big step forward. As for adaptation, I think there will be no problems.

The coaching staff was very friendly from day one, the athletic director told me I could call anytime.

Everyone wants to help me feel at home as soon as possible. And I will do everything to make this happen as quickly as possible,” Slavia’s official website quotes Domchak as saying..

We would like to remind you that this season Domchak played 29 matches for Karpaty in all tournaments, conceding 28 goals, and kept his goal intact in 15 matches.
